We are pretty much pioneers when it comes to modifying Mercedes cars, not many people mod Mercedes compared to other cars. Even aftermarket support is slim compared to other brands. So you need to figure out what you want to accomplish and what you are willling to spend to accomplish that task. Of course you can mod a chevy for cheap to attain your goals, but that's because a lot more people have done it before you and there is more support for the vehicle.
In order to get the results you want, you're definitely going to need to think out of the box and spend a bit of money. If you're capable off following instructions and you can do the work yourself, you might be able to accomplish what you want cheaper than what you thought you could.
I have a C55 and I really would love to throw a w211 E55 engine in the car, but the best way to do that would be to buy a wrecked E55 and transfer everything over to the C55. I'm sure it's easier said than done, but that's probably the cheapest way of modding the C55 into a fast car. I'm guessing around 12k more or less for the car and then sell what ever you can. Should come out to around to 8k without labor. Buying a wrecjed E55 might be a long shot, but it's the cheapest way of probably gettting into the 11's.
